Bollywood actor Salman Khan is busy shooting Dabang 3 these days. Prabhudeva is directing this film. Dabang Khan wants to finish shooting the film as soon as possible and he is currently shooting the film Climax and wants to finish it soon. It was also reported for quite some time that Salman's brother-in-law Atul Agnihotri had bought Hindi rights of a Korean hit film. Makers did not decide the name of the film. But now the name of the film has also been fixed. Let us know.

In fact, according to the latest information, Salman Khan's film will be named 'Radhe' (Radhe Movie). Prabhudeva will direct the film. It will be an action-thriller movie. This is the Hindi remake of the Korean film on which the work will start soon.

In the film, Salman can be seen in police uniforms or in the role of detectives. Remind me, Salman Khan's film Wanted also had Salman's spy name Radhe, and Prabhudeva stepped into the field of direction from the same film. But this film will not be 'Wanted 2'.

It is also reported that Salman Khan will start shoot 'Radhe' after his film Dabang 3 shooting finishes. The film's producer will be Atul Agnihotri. The film is expected to be released on Eid next year. If that happens, Salman will start shooting 'Kick 2' only after 'Radhe'. The Kick 2 movie is believed to be released on Christmas next year.
